While early jets have a lower range compared to turboprops, it should still be possible to get jet aircraft (not rocket) with decent range on a 0.5g/50% air density planet. The largest fuel tank is usually too large and slows the plane down too much - in order to maximize range, engines, wings and fuel tanks all usually need to be of a balanced size, but there is no straightforward generally applicable rule for the exact sizes, they have to be figured out through trial and error.

Designing an aircraft model unlocks the next size of aircraft model for discovery. If you don't want to discover bigger aircraft types, then don't keep designing bigger ones - large fixed-wing aircraft are rarely useful anyway.

The interface for designing aircraft being egregiously terrible is something there's a general agreement in the community on. If you don't want to bother with it, there's an option to disable air forces in the planet generation settings.

Maybe i misunderstood the 'problem', but if you are trying to discover other things like artillery or other undiscovered types, then stop wasting points on designing new planes. Dont' design anything - let those points all roll into the discovery pool.

Designing new planes will only make sense after you've researched the associated efficiency techs for aviation and a little bit after the type you are trying to improve has gained battle experience.

The latest beta patches have a new interface under MNG -> Blue for designing model blueprints, which can then be used when picking the next model to design for the Model Design Council. It's ten times quicker for designing effective air units compared to the interface in the model design decision.
